Leetcode 326:Power of Three

来源:互联网 发布:sql count1什么意思 编辑:程序博客网 时间:2024/05/22 06:27

Given an integer, write a function to determine if it is a power of three.

Follow up:
Could you do it without using any loop / recursion?

Special thanks to @dietpepsi for adding this problem and creating all test cases.

Subscribe to see which companies asked this question

//给定一个整数,编写函数判断它是否为3的幂class Solution {public:    bool isPowerOfThree(int n) {        if(n>1)        {            while(n%3==0)                n=n/3;        }        return n==1;    }};

0 0